MessagePack反序列化使用示例

1.MessagePack简单示例

1.1 引入jar包

1.2 传输对象必须要引入注解@Message,且要有默认构造函数

@Message
public class MsgEntity {

    private String id;
    private String name;

    public MsgEntity() {

    }
……
}

1.3 demo演示

// 创建MessagePack
        MessagePack messagePack = new MessagePack();
        MsgEntity meite = new MsgEntity(UUID.randomUUID().toString(), "我是jarye");
        // 序列化
        byte[] bs = messagePack.write(meite);
        Value read1 = messagePack.read(bs);
        System.out.println(read1);
//        // 反序列化
        MsgEntity read = messagePack.read(bs, MsgEntity.class);
        System.out.println(read);

2.MessagePack在netty中的使用

2.1 netty中编码器和解码器定义

public class MsgpackDecoder extends MessageToMessageDecoder<ByteBuf> {
    @Override
    protected void decode(ChannelHandlerContext channelHandlerContext, ByteBuf byteBuf, List<Object> list) throws Exception {
        final int length = byteBuf.readableBytes();
        byte[] b = new byte[length];
        byteBuf.getBytes(byteBuf.readerIndex(), b, 0, length);
        MessagePack msgpack = new MessagePack();
        list.add(msgpack.read(b));
    }
}
public class MsgpackEncoder extends MessageToByteEncoder {

    @Override
    protected void encode(ChannelHandlerContext channelHandlerContext, Object msg, ByteBuf byteBuf) throws Exception {
        MessagePack msgpack = new MessagePack();
        byteBuf.writeBytes(msgpack.write(msg));
    }
}

2.2 注册到netty中

ch.pipeline().addLast(new MsgpackDecoder());
ch.pipeline().addLast(new MsgpackEncoder());

2.3 数据传输和接收可以直接使用对象形式了

public class ClientHandler extends SimpleChannelInboundHandler<Object> {

    @Override
    public void channelActive(ChannelHandlerContext ctx) throws Exception {
        MsgEntity msgEntity = new MsgEntity(UUID.randomUUID().toString(), "我是jarye");
        ctx.writeAndFlush(msgEntity);
    }

    @Override
    protected void channelRead0(ChannelHandlerContext channelHandlerContext, Object o) throws Exception {
        System.out.println("resp:"+o);
    }
}
public class ServerHandler extends SimpleChannelInboundHandler<Object> {
    @Override
    protected void channelRead0(ChannelHandlerContext channelHandlerContext, Object o) throws Exception {
        System.out.println("o:" + o);
    }
}
